Born: July 17, 1850 in Benton, New Hampshire, USA
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Albinus Morse married Harriet E "Hattie" GRAY (GREY) 25 July 1883 in Haverhill, New Hampshire, USA .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Harriet E "Hattie" GRAY (GREY) was born August 29, 1854 in Altona, New York, USA. Harriet E "Hattie" died March 30, 1926 in St Albans, Vermont, USA. Harriet E "Hattie" was the child of Daniel GRAY and Mary Frances MEAD.
Albinus Morse WELLS died March 1940 in St Albans, Vermont, USA.
